Mithuna Sankranti or Sankranthi

Mithuna Sankranti is observed in the beginning of the third month of Hindu Solar Calendar. There are twelve Sankrantis in every year and all of them are highly auspicious for doing Dan-Punya activities. However, it should be remembered that only some specific time duration before or after each Sankranti muhurta is considered auspicious for doing Sankranti related activities.

In case of Mithuna Sankranti, sixteen Ghatis after the Sankranti moment are considered auspicious and hence the timeframe from Sankranti to sixteen Ghatis after Sankranti is taken for performing all Dan-Punya activities.

Gifting of cow, known as Godan, is considered highly auspicious during Mithuna Sankranti.

The current date of Mithuna Sankranti falls on 14th June or on 15th June. In South India Sankranti is also called as Sankramanam.
